Picture Quality and Performance
When it comes to picture quality, the LG Gallery Series OLED TV shines bright. Each individual pixel emits its own light, enabling the deepest blacks and vibrant colors. The self-lighting pixels ensure a high contrast ratio that is integral for lifelike images. LG’s α9 Gen 3 AI Processor 4K is at the helm, providing intelligent upscaling and optimizing every scene. HDR content dazzles with Dolby Vision IQ, dynamically adjusting the picture settings based on ambient lighting conditions and content genres. Gamers will also appreciate the G-SYNC compatibility and low input lag, making this TV a top contender for the gaming community.

Connectivity
Connectivity is comprehensive, boasting a suite of inputs that cater to everyone from the casual viewer to the tech-savvy individual. Multiple HDMI 2.1 ports ensure future-proofing for the latest consoles and high-definition content.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and Apple AirPlay 2 provide seamless integration with your other smart devices. This allows for easy streaming, sharing of content, and even control of your TV using your smartphone.
Pros and Cons
Pros:
- Sleek, wall-mountable design accentuates modern living spaces
- Outstanding picture quality with true blacks and vibrant colors
- Advanced α9 Gen 3 AI Processor 4K elevates viewing to new heights
- Immersive Dolby Atmos audio without the need for external speakers
- G-SYNC compatibility and low input lag ideal for gaming
- Intuitive webOS smart platform with LG Magic Remote
Cons:
- Premium price point may be a consideration for some buyers
- Potential for burn-in with static images requires careful use
- Limited upgradeability compared to modular TV systems
